PIRATE MEN FINISH 10TH OUT OF 24 TEAMS AT SOUTH/SOUTHEAST REGIONAL

GREENSBORO, N.C. - The Southwestern University men's cross country team had a fantastic showing at the DIII South/Southeast Regional held at Guilford College. Senior Dan Rudd (pictured) led the way for the Pirates, coming in 37th place in a time of 28:50.

Despite the warm, humid weather and muddy racing conditions that have seemed to follow the Pirates all season the men tied their best finish ever at the Regional meet, 10th place, which was also accomplished in 2004 and 2005.

Rudd’s 37th place finish was highest for the Pirates while sophomore Zach Freeland came in 47th overall in just over 29 minutes. Senior Josh Gideon and Matthew Broussard were strong in their final race with Gideon taking 65th place in a time of 29:40 while Broussard finished in 31:05 for 110th place.

First-year Thomas Bobbitt closed out his first collegiate season with a 76th place finish in a time of 30:13. Junior Allen Smith was close behind, finishing in 30:19 for 82nd place while first-year Sam Martinez placed 141st in a time of 32:24.

The Regionals race marked the end of the Pirates season.
